Guangzhou (CAN) to Kuala Terengganu (TGG) Flight Distance
The flight distance from Guangzhou Baiyun International Airport (CAN) in Guangzhou, China to Sultan Mahmud Airport (TGG) in Kuala Terengganu, Malaysia is 2,282 kilometers (1,418 miles / 1,232 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 4h, flying south southwest at a heading of 210°.
